Triumph Other description

1999 Triumph Legend , This is a rare custom Built 1999 Triumph Legend TT. Located in Portland Oregon British made Hinckley Triple 900 with dual exhaust and Mono shock suspension. Absolutely Beautiful bike. Runs great, functions great, and needs nothing. 15K Custom build includes: All Tin work Powder Coated (not painted) Gun Metal Gray Norman Hyde M-bars CRG style bar end mirrors Emgo slip-ons Custom cowl by Airtech Fender eliminator kit with super bright LED tail light Very rare and sought after light weight AKRONT 17 inch Aluminum wheels This bike has had close to 40 pound of stuff stripped off of it and is fast, handles great, and fun to ride. If you want the Classic Retro look and styling of a Bonneville or Thruxton, but enjoy the Performance, Handling, and Engineering of a modern bike, this is the bike for you. $5,000.00 5033186736

2013 LA Calendar Motorcycle Show Report

Mon, 22 Jul 2013

The 22nd edition of the annual LA Calendar Motorcycle Show marked its return to the Queen Mary Seawalk Village in Long Beach, California with hometown boy Sam Baldi taking the Bike Building Championship’s Best of Show trophy with a Jimmy Todorovith/Profile Cycles built Big Twin custom named “Lost Angel.” This year’s Calendar Show showcased not only top builders but selected vendors and exhibitors, and of course the Calendar Girl Music live performances. And as always, this year’s show celebrated the world premiere of the 2014 FastDates.com Motorcycle PinUp Calendars, featuring the world’s top SBK World Superbikes, sport and cafe bikes, and custom motorcycles with the beautiful Calendar Kittens. On hand throughout the day to meet with fans and pose for pictures were Calendar Kittens Apple Price, together with official SBK World Superbike grid girls Jessica Harbour and singer/songwriter Sarah Horvath.

A Triumph Bonneville Unlike Any Other

Thu, 16 Jan 2014

The Bucephalus is not just another “Old Meets New” custom. It’s a completely fresh idea from Loaded Gun Customs, builders of other wild machines, combining a 1967 Triumph Bonneville twin — an iconic engine in its own right — and surrounding it with state-of-the-art performance components. Basically, if motorcycle engines ceased production in 1967, this would be a modern day racebike.
